MAURICEVILLE

PRESENTATIONS MADE DANCE HELD LAST EVENING (“Times-Age” Special.) There was a large gathering of district residents and visitors at Mauriceville West last night when Private P. Foster and Staff-Sergeant Donald Cameron were the guests of honour. The music for the dancing was supplied by Miss Betty Grant and Mr Dick of Hastwells assisted on the drums.. Sergeant Pilot L. Forsberg was an efficient M.C. On behalf of the Mauriceville West committee, Mr A. Forsberg made a presentation to Private Foster and for the East committee Mr E. W. Cheetham made a presentation to Staff-Sergeant Cameron. Both men suitably replied. A Monte Carlo waltz was won by Mrs J. Baine and Mr G. Ruston. Supper was served by the West committee.
